Bayhorse Silver Inc. (CVE:BHS – Get Free Report)’s stock price rose 16.7% during trading on Monday . The stock traded as high as C$0.08 and last traded at C$0.07. Approximately 720,314 shares traded hands during mid-day trading, an increase of 97% from the average daily volume of 365,981 shares. The stock had previously closed at C$0.06.

About Bayhorse Silver
Bayhorse Silver Inc, a junior natural resource company, engages in the acquisition, exploration, and development of natural resource properties. It explores for silver, gold, zinc, copper, antimony, lead, and other metals. The company holds a 100% interest in the Bayhorse Silver Mine Property located in Baker County, Oregon.
